Symbiotic Origin of Aging.
Rejuvenation research - 1 Jun 2018
Greenberg Edward F, Vatolin Sergei
Abstract excerpt
Normally aging cells are characterized by an unbalanced mitochondrial dynamic skewed toward punctate mitochondria. Genetic and pharmacological manipulation of mitochondrial fission/fusion cycles can contribute to both accelerated and decelerated cellular or organismal aging. In this work, we connect these experimental data with the symbiotic theory of mitochondrial origin to generate new insight into the...
